Apple
(Pyrus malus)
Planet: Venus
Element: Water
Energies: Love, health, peace
Lore: The peoples who inhabited the prehistoric lake dwellings of Switzerland enjoyed apples, as shown by apple remains found there.105 Apples may have been eaten as long ago as the Paleolithic era.
They were a valued food in ancient Egypt. Ramses III offered 848 baskets of apples to Hapy, the Egyptian god of the Nile.23 Among the Norse, Iduna safeguarded a store of apples. When eaten, the apples gave the gift of perpetual youth to the goddesses and gods.90 It is said that certain Norse priests were forbidden to eat apples, due to the fruit’s legendary lustful properties.62 Apples are still offered to Chango among the Yoruba.
Apple trees once grew around the sacred island of Avalon in England, and apples were intimately linked with spirituality in the British Isles.
At one time, apples were always rubbed before they were eaten to remove all the demons or evil spirits that were thought to reside within them. Even the smell of fresh apples was thought to bestow longevity and restore flagging physical strength.

Banana
(Musa spp.)
Planet: Mars
Element: Air
Energies: Spirituality, love, money
Lore: The banana is mentioned throughout the sacred books of India, and is still considered to be a holy food. A valued offering to Hindu deities, the banana’s leaves are used to decorate marriage altars.2
Stalks of the banana plant (it is not a tree) were sometimes offered in place of humans during sacrificial rites in the Pacific.7 Polynesian legends tell of the creation of the original banana plant from the bodies of slain heroes.7
In old New Orleans, the plants were grown for luck near the home. In Hawaii, food wrapped in large banana leaves was thought to be safe from intruding negativity.7
Though we know little of the banana’s orgins, it’s certain that people in India were enjoying the slippery fruits in about 2000 b.c.e.; that bananas arrived in Africa in 500 c.e., in Polynesia around 1000 c.e., and in tropical America during the fifteenth and sixteenth centuries.71 Bananas were introduced to consumers in North America at the 1876 Philadelphia Exposition. Not long afterward, thousands of tons were being imported and purchased by an appreciative populace.2 Most of the bananas we eat today are grown in Ecuador.
During the 1960s, banana peels were sometimes smoked as a replacement for marijuana. Though this had little or no effect beyond suggestion, it is curious that banana peels actually do contain minute amounts of the psychoactive substances serotonin, norepinephrine, and dopamine.52, 71 Fortunately, smoking the peels had little effect and the fad quickly died out.
Don’t eat bright yellow bananas. Those who dislike the taste of bananas may have never eaten a ripe one. Bananas are ripe only when the peel has begun to turn brown. The more brown spots, the more sugar that has been formed within the fruit.

Citron
(Citrus medica)
Planet: Sun
Element: Fire
Energies: Strength
Lore: Citron was first used in Egypt in the second century c.e.23 Though we may not encounter this fruit except in Yuletide fruitcakes, citron was once accorded a lofty place in the world. Pliny wrote that it was grown around temples dedicated to Amon in ancient Egypt. Citron was thought to have been created by Ge (the Egyptian god of the earth) to celebrate the wedding of Zeus and Hera. This myth was obviously formed during the influx of Greek thought into Egypt.23
In Mediterranean countries, citron is still used to drive away the “evil eye.”

Fig
(Ficus carica)
Planet: Jupiter
Element: Fire
Energies: Strength, money, sex
Lore: Figs are often depicted on Egyptian tomb paintings and reliefs. At ancient Thebes, Pharaoh Ramses III offered 15,500 measures of figs to Amon-Ra.23 They were also apparently eaten during certain rituals, such as those in honor of Thoth.23
The fig was sacred in ancient Greece and was associated with many deities, including Dionysius and Juno.
A fig isn’t actually a fruit; it is a hollow, bud-like object filled with immature flowers and mature seeds.90

Mango
(Mangifera indica)
Planet: Mars
Element: Fire
Energies: Protection, sex, love
Lore: The mango is native to India and Malaysia and has been cultivated in those countries for 4,000 years.58 Around 600 b.c.e., in India, a special mango grove was presented to Buddha as a quiet place for meditation. Vedic magicians used mangos in preparing love philtres.106 Today, Hindus use mango leaves as symbols of prosperity and happiness in various religious festivals.58
The mango is extremely popular in Central America and Mexico. In Guatemala, women eat the juicy, fleshy fruits to promote sexual excitement. In Hawaii, dreams filled with the fruit indicate prosperous times ahead.102
Eating this gooey fruit involves all the senses: the texture of the peel and the meat; the golden-reddish color of the flesh; the scent of the juice; the sound of the fruit squishing between your teeth; and the delicious taste. I’ve often ended up completely drenched with mango juice after a particularly satisfying encounter with this sacred fruit of India.

Pomegranate
(Punica granatum)
Planet: Mercury
Element: Fire
Energies: Fertility, creativity, money
Lore: Throughout Mesopotamia and the Mediterranean, this many-seeded fruit was linked with deity. The Hittites attributed the pomegranate to Ibritz, their god of agriculture. The Greeks depicted Zeus holding a pomegranate;23 the redness of the seeds also suggested that the fruit sprung from the blood of Dionysius. The pomegranate also played a symbolic role in early Judaic symbolism.23
Representations of pomegranates abound in the art of antiquity, such as the famous pomegranate-shaped silver jar found in Tutankhaman’s tomb. The fruits were used as money—barter and cash—in ancient Egypt.23
Pomegranates were served at Babylonian marriage banquets. Pomegranate seeds were also offered to guests during Asian weddings, much as we put out bowls of nuts.
In contemporary American folklore, these are “lucky” fruits. A wish is always made before eating the fruit’s first seeds.

Watermelon
(Citrullus vulgaris)
Planet: Moon
Element: Water
Energies: Healing
Lore: What could be a more all-American food than watermelon? Many plants, in fact, including wild rice, corn, and potatoes. The watermelon is native to Africa and was brought to our continent during the saddest and most savage time in our history—the time of trafficking of human beings.29
The watermelon was introduced to Egypt in about 2000 b.c.e.71 Ancient Egyptians mixed watermelon juice with wine and gave this drink to ill persons who were believed to be possessed by illness-causing demons.69 Watermelon was mythological related to the god Set, and Egyptian women may have eaten watermelon in prescriptions designed to cause weight gain.69
In Hawaii, a watermelon is sometimes rolled out of the house through the front door to ease the spirit of a deceased person into the next world.18
Watermelon is sacred to the goddess Yemaya in the various manifestations of the Yoruba religion.
